Transaction 70e986557656a790837550eb85e29c08ea8ae1fb164b65e45c045acfdc75e121
2 Input
2 Outputs
- 70e986557656a790837550eb85e29c08ea8ae1fb164b65e45c045acfdc75e121:0
- 70e986557656a790837550eb85e29c08ea8ae1fb164b65e45c045acfdc75e121:1
value 880066
address 17Hi6rVivQTPvvxTsPJivMawEtUV9Z5ecm
value 1070858
address 165atZ5v848RF7GBLcqQsAsQRP4pLtXur6